Sausages with mint and honey.......


(Makes 50 this sounds a lot but, I promise you, they won't last!)

1 pkt 5o mini sausages
200g honey
1 handful fresh mint or 2 and a half tsps dried mint

Preheat the oven to 200'c. Mix the honey with the sausages and place in a baking tray. Pop them in the oven for 20 minutes until they are plump. Take out of the oven and leave on the sideboard to cool for 15 mins. Add the finely sliced mint and mix through. Spear with a cocktail stick and eat!
